[bodytext] => She asked for hugs the other day, but all the reasons to hug have flown away. I avoid her when I can so not to her appear cold, for emotions once held in my heart I no longer hold An explosion started the love to abrade, afterward I saw caring too had begun to fade. Into my heart, into my soul, I in desperation seek, a landscape that was love, but now is bleak. I know I should tell her how she appears, and me thinking all has been a lie this year. I want to believe what she has to say, but my trust in her has gone away. Made up my mind, as she speaks I won't think of disimilation, I will accept her at her word, make an accomidation. I can do this, I know I can, I will give her my trust, for she is worth it, and do it I must. Another weary fight to make something of this, a rusty old knight, just wanting peace and bliss. I know she is worth it, so I will make one more start, for the daughter not of my blood, but of my heart.
